Market Dynamics and Industry Landscape of Japan Formaldehyde Colorimetric Tube Market
The Japan Formaldehyde Colorimetric Tube Market is characterized by a mature yet evolving landscape, driven by rigorous safety standards and environmental policies. The sector is primarily focused on portable, easy-to-use detection devices that facilitate rapid on-site analysis. The industry’s maturity reflects high adoption rates among industrial facilities, laboratories, and environmental agencies, with incremental innovations enhancing sensitivity, specificity, and user convenience.
Market growth is underpinned by Japan’s commitment to occupational health and environmental preservation, prompting continuous upgrades in detection technology. The competitive environment features a mix of established multinational corporations and innovative startups, fostering a dynamic ecosystem. Regulatory frameworks, such as Japan’s Industrial Safety and Health Act, enforce strict limits on formaldehyde exposure, catalyzing demand for reliable measurement tools. As the sector matures, strategic partnerships, technological convergence, and regional expansion are expected to shape future trajectories, with a focus on integrating digital solutions and IoT connectivity for smarter monitoring.
Japan Formaldehyde Colorimetric Tube Market: Strategic Positioning and Competitive Forces
Applying Porter’s Five Forces to the Japan Formaldehyde Colorimetric Tube Market reveals a landscape with moderate supplier power, given the specialized nature of chemical reagents and detection components. Buyer power remains high due to the critical need for accuracy and compliance, prompting demand for high-quality, certified products. Threat of new entrants is moderate, supported by technological barriers and regulatory approvals, yet innovation-driven startups are gradually penetrating the market.
Competitive rivalry is intense, with key players competing on product reliability, calibration accuracy, and after-sales support. Substitutes such as electronic sensors and laboratory-based analyzers pose a threat but are less portable and less suited for rapid field assessments. The overall industry attractiveness is driven by regulatory pressures and the increasing importance of real-time monitoring, creating a resilient environment for established firms and innovative entrants alike. Strategic focus on R&D, regional expansion, and digital integration will be pivotal for sustained growth and market dominance.

Japan Formaldehyde Colorimetric Tube Market: Regulatory Environment and Policy Impact
Japan’s regulatory landscape exerts a profound influence on the Formaldehyde Colorimetric Tube Market, with stringent occupational safety laws and environmental standards shaping product development and market entry. The Ministry of Health, Labour and Welfare enforces exposure limits and mandates regular monitoring, creating a consistent demand for reliable detection tools. Policies promoting industrial safety and environmental sustainability further incentivize innovation and adoption of advanced measurement solutions.
Recent amendments to chemical safety regulations emphasize real-time, portable detection methods, aligning with global best practices. The government’s push for green manufacturing and pollution control enhances market prospects, especially in sectors like automotive, electronics, and chemical processing. Compliance requirements also foster partnerships between device manufacturers and regulatory bodies, ensuring product standards and facilitating market expansion. Navigating this complex policy environment demands continuous adaptation and strategic foresight from industry stakeholders, emphasizing the importance of regulatory intelligence and proactive compliance strategies.
